Though they hunt, a finger monkey’s Major foods source is tree sap. The marmosets have sharp tooth that enable them dig holes and peel the tree’s bark again. The monkeys maintain heading to the bark right until they Identify the sap, and as soon as they are doing, they consume it like a cat beverages h2o from its bowl.

Equally male and feminine pygmy marmosets are orange-brown. Each hair has stripes of brown and black, termed agouti coloring. This coloration offers them good camouflage. A mane of hair addresses the pygmy marmoset's ears.

The Pygmy Marmoset, generally known as the dwarf monkey or pocket monkey, is the smallest species of monkey on this planet. They are native towards the rainforests of South America, especially the Amazon basin. With an average length of about 5 to six inches and weighing only three to four ounces, these tiny primates have distinctive attributes including their extended claws along with a attribute hair tuft on their head.

Undoubtedly from my very own discipline observations, it seemed that many social interactions have been done on large horizontal or Carefully sloping branches which ended up relatively out within the open — potentially to present very good predator detection viewing (pers. obs.). A new comparative analyze on captive callitrichids has revealed that species do have preferences for particular diameters and orientations of branches (Seymour & Kinghorn, pers. comm.), so once more the significant issue here is to deliver variability in department orientation and diameter.
